Overall Meaning

The lyrics of "All I Know" by Stitches narrate the struggles that come with the drug dealing lifestyle. The artist explores the challenges and consequences of drug dealing, emphasizing the trap that comes with the lifestyle, hence the difficulty in stopping. Stitches reflects on the reality of the situation, stating that although he has tried to stop, there's a limit to what he can do since selling drugs is all he knows. The lyrics reveal the paranoia that drug dealers experience in their everyday trades, given the looming threat of being caught by law enforcement agencies, which is why they develop trust issues.


Stitches admits that he is aware of the risk involved in such a lifestyle but emphasizes that he's doing it for the money. The chorus emphasizes the trap that comes with the lifestyle, acknowledging that it is all he knows and questioning whether he has any options. The lyrics also address the materialistic aspect of the drug dealing lifestyle, as the artist brags about his possessions, stating that drugs afforded him the opportunity to acquire them. Stitches depicts his resilience and determination to maintain his tough image despite the challenges and risks associated with the lifestyle.
